Joining The Downey Legend for the first time, 17-year-old writer and Public Relations Manager, Lucy Hernandez feels, “Newspaper is interesting because it gets me out of my comfort zone, my box.” She enjoys writing and hopes to dig up interesting stories for The Downey Legend regarding the community and the school. As for public relations, Hernandez will be planning parties, celebrating birthdays with staff members, and arranging bonding days.  Although it may seem as if public relations is a easy job, it requires an enthusiastic, patient, and outgoing person in which Hernandez fits perfectly.

 

During her spare time, Hernandez likes listening to alternative music by Anthony Green, which helps her calm down and relax. As far as her favorite food goes, she prefers sushi over anything else. “I can eat sushi every day if I could,” Hernandez said. She loves dogs and has a Cockapoo that’s three years old named Max; she loves taking him for long walks around town. In a few years Hernandez sees herself reaching her goals and attending a university in London. She plans to major in English and Journalism, and intends on living an independent life with no kids and exploring the world. Hernandez has a bright future ahead of her and she won’t stop chasing her dreams until she reaches the top. With that said, she aspires to start the year with a positive attitude.
